// --- Spans --------------------------------------------------------------------

/// A successful GET emits an OTel Client span with the required HTTP semantic
/// convention attributes.
#[tokio::test]
async fn h1_records_client_span() {
    let ctx = integration_context();
    let addr = spawn_server(Router::new().route("/", get(|| async { "hello" }))).await;
    let req = http::Request::builder()
        .method(http::Method::GET)
        .uri(format!("http://{addr}/"))
        .body(empty_body())
        .unwrap();
    let _ = new_client(&default_config())
        .oneshot(req)
        .await
        .expect("ok");

    span_snapshot!(ctx, @r#"
    - name: GET
      span_kind: Client
      is_sampled: true
      attributes:
        http.request.method: GET
        http.response.status_code: "200"
        network.protocol.version: "1.1"
        server.address: 127.0.0.1
        server.port: "<port>"
        url.full: "http://127.0.0.1:<port>/"
    "#);
}

/// A 4xx response sets `error.type` on the span and marks the span status as Error.
#[tokio::test]
async fn h1_4xx_sets_span_error_status() {
    let ctx = integration_context();
    let addr =
        spawn_server(Router::new().route("/", get(|| async { http::StatusCode::NOT_FOUND }))).await;
    let req = http::Request::builder()
        .method(http::Method::GET)
        .uri(format!("http://{addr}/"))
        .body(empty_body())
        .unwrap();
    let _ = new_client(&default_config())
        .oneshot(req)
        .await
        .expect("ok");

    span_snapshot!(ctx, @r#"
    - name: GET
      span_kind: Client
      is_sampled: true
      attributes:
        error.type: "404"
        http.request.method: GET
        http.response.status_code: "404"
        network.protocol.version: "1.1"
        server.address: 127.0.0.1
        server.port: "<port>"
        url.full: "http://127.0.0.1:<port>/"
      status: Error
    "#);
}

/// Opt-in body size span attributes record the actual bytes sent and received.
#[tokio::test]
async fn h1_span_records_opt_in_body_sizes() {
    let ctx = integration_context();
    let addr =
        spawn_server(Router::new().route("/", post(|_body: axum::body::Bytes| async { "hello" })))
            .await;
    let config = parse_config(indoc! {"
        telemetry:
          spans:
            request_body_size: true
            response_body_size: true
    "});
    let req = http::Request::builder()
        .method(http::Method::POST)
        .uri(format!("http://{addr}/"))
        .body(bytes_body(Bytes::from(vec![0u8; 10])))
        .unwrap();
    let resp = new_client(&config).oneshot(req).await.expect("ok");
    resp.into_body().collect().await.unwrap();

    span_snapshot!(ctx, @r#"
    - name: POST
      span_kind: Client
      is_sampled: true
      attributes:
        http.request.body.size: "10"
        http.request.method: POST
        http.response.body.size: "5"
        http.response.status_code: "200"
        network.protocol.version: "1.1"
        server.address: 127.0.0.1
        server.port: "<port>"
        url.full: "http://127.0.0.1:<port>/"
    "#);
}

/// Request and response headers are captured as span attributes when configured.
#[tokio::test]
async fn h1_captures_request_and_response_headers() {
    let ctx = integration_context();
    let addr = spawn_server(Router::new().route(
        "/",
        get(|| async {
            let mut resp = axum::response::Response::new(axum::body::Body::empty());
            resp.headers_mut()
                .insert("x-trace-id", "trace-abc".parse().unwrap());
            resp
        }),
    ))
    .await;
    let config = parse_config(indoc! {"
        telemetry:
          spans:
            request_headers:
              - x-request-id
            response_headers:
              - x-trace-id
    "});
    let req = http::Request::builder()
        .method(http::Method::GET)
        .uri(format!("http://{addr}/"))
        .header("x-request-id", "req-123")
        .body(empty_body())
        .unwrap();
    let _ = new_client(&config).oneshot(req).await.expect("ok");

    span_snapshot!(ctx, @r#"
    - name: GET
      span_kind: Client
      is_sampled: true
      attributes:
        http.request.header.x-request-id: "[\"req-123\"]"
        http.request.method: GET
        http.response.header.x-trace-id: "[\"trace-abc\"]"
        http.response.status_code: "200"
        network.protocol.version: "1.1"
        server.address: 127.0.0.1
        server.port: "<port>"
        url.full: "http://127.0.0.1:<port>/"
    "#);
}
